The Jewish High Holy Days this year have also been a time of reflection and mourning a year after the Oct. 7 attacks by Hamas.

Rhode Island playwright Sandy Laub wrote a one-person play after the tragedy called “Picking Up Stones: An American Jew Wakes to a Nightmare.”

She sat down with Alex Nunes of The Public’s Radio to share her thoughts a year after the attacks.
